Planning Your Online Course

How to create and sell an online course

To create a successful online course, you need to start with a solid plan. This includes identifying your target audience, defining your course topic, and outlining your course content. You can use tools like Trello or Asana to organize your ideas and create a course outline.

Once you have a clear plan, you can start creating your course content. This can include video lessons, text-based lessons, quizzes, and assignments. You can use platforms like Udemy or Teachable to host your course and manage your content.

Creating Engaging Course Content

How to create and sell an online course

Creating engaging course content is crucial to the success of your online course. You need to make sure that your content is informative, interactive, and visually appealing. You can use tools like ScreenFlow or Camtasia to create high-quality video lessons, and Canva to design visually appealing graphics and slides.

In addition to creating high-quality content, you also need to make sure that your course is well-structured and easy to follow. You can use a course template to help you organize your content and create a logical flow.

Marketing and Selling Your Online Course

How to create and sell an online course

Once you've created your online course, you need to market and sell it to your target audience. You can use social media platforms like Facebook or Twitter to promote your course, and email marketing to reach out to potential customers.

You can also use paid advertising platforms like Google AdWords or Facebook Ads to reach a wider audience. You can set a budget of a few dollars per day and target specific demographics and interests.

Launching and Delivering Your Online Course

How to create and sell an online course

Once you've marketed and sold your online course, you need to deliver it to your customers. You can use platforms like Udemy or Teachable to host your course and manage your customer interactions.

You can also use tools like Zapier or Integromat to automate your course delivery and customer support. You can set up automated emails and notifications to keep your customers engaged and informed.
